This patch (as778) adds a field to struct usb_device to store the
device's level in the USB tree.  In itself this number isn't really
important.  But the overhead is very low, and in a later patch it will
be used for preventing bogus warnings from the lockdep checker.

diff --git a/drivers/usb/core/hub.c b/drivers/usb/core/hub.c
index f5adce0..78e910b 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/core/hub.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/core/hub.c
@@ -2414,6 +2414,7 @@ #endif
                usb_set_device_state(udev, USB_STATE_POWERED);
                udev->speed = USB_SPEED_UNKNOWN;
                udev->bus_mA = hub->mA_per_port;
+               udev->level = hdev->level + 1;
 
                /* set the address */
                choose_address(udev);
diff --git a/include/linux/usb.h b/include/linux/usb.h
index c663032..df5c93e 100644
--- a/include/linux/usb.h
+++ b/include/linux/usb.h
@@ -348,6 +348,7 @@ struct usb_device {
 
        unsigned short bus_mA;          /* Current available from the bus */
        u8 portnum;                     /* Parent port number (origin 1) */
+       u8 level;                       /* Number of USB hub ancestors */
 
        int have_langid;                /* whether string_langid is valid */
        int string_langid;              /* language ID for strings */
